Ink Quality and Type
Choosing the right ink quality and type is essential for artists seeking to elevate their work. Opt for alcohol-based inks if you want vibrant colors and smooth application, as they blend easily and dry quickly. Low-odor formulations can enhance your coloring experience, especially during long sessions, keeping those strong chemical scents at bay. Permanent ink markers are ideal for resisting fading and smudging, guaranteeing your artwork remains intact over time and works on various surfaces without running. Additionally, consider the type of tip—whether chisel, fine, or brush—as it influences line thickness and style versatility. Finally, check customer feedback on brands to confirm consistent ink flow and color accuracy, avoiding potential issues like streakiness or drying out.

Drying Time and Performance
An impressive color selection is just the beginning when it comes to professional coloring markers; how quickly they dry can greatly impact your artistic process. Quick-drying ink is essential for preventing smudging and ensuring clean lines, especially if you’re layering or blending. Alcohol-based markers generally dry faster than their water-based counterparts, making them ideal if you need immediate results. Keep in mind that drying times can vary between brands; some markers are designed to minimize bleed-through on different paper types. However, markers that dry too quickly might not give you enough time to blend effectively. Consistent drying performance is vital—uneven drying can lead to streaks or patchy coverage, affecting the overall quality of your artwork.

Safety and Non-Toxicity
Guaranteeing the safety and non-toxicity of your professional coloring markers is essential, especially if you’re working in shared spaces or around children. Look for markers labeled as non-toxic, as this indicates they’re safe for sensitive individuals. Opting for water-based ink is a smart choice; these markers emit fewer harmful fumes compared to solvent-based options. Always check for compliance with safety standards like ASTM D-4236 or EN71, confirming they’ve been tested for harmful substances. Non-toxic markers typically use pigments instead of dyes, which enhances safety while providing vibrant colors. Additionally, labels that state “non-toxic” and “acid-free” guarantee your artwork remains safe and lasts longer. Prioritize these factors to protect both yourself and your creative environment.
